Water retaining membrane for spinal endoscopic surgery
Technical Field
The utility model belongs to the field of medical operation auxiliary articles, and particularly relates to a spinal endoscopic operation water-retaining membrane.
Background
Clinically, spinal endoscopy operation is divided into two channel access modes of posterior access and lateral posterior access, wherein the posterior access mode has the characteristics of high efficiency, reduced operation time, less patient injury and the like and is widely applied to clinic, and the endoscopic operation uses flushing liquid (normal saline) as a medium, so that the operation field is clear, and bleeding is reduced. However, outflow or extravasation of large volumes of irrigant fluid can penetrate the dressing, thereby contaminating the surgical site and risking infection.
Disclosure of Invention
Aiming at the problems, the utility model makes up the defects of the prior art and provides a water-retaining skin membrane for spinal endoscopic surgery; the utility model can effectively collect and reduce the outflow or extravasation of the flushing fluid.
In order to achieve the purpose, the utility model adopts the following technical scheme.
The utility model provides a water retaining membrane for a spinal endoscopic surgery, which comprises a membrane and is characterized in that a double-faced rubber plate is arranged on the lower surface of the upper part of the membrane, a water collecting bag is arranged on the lower part of the membrane, a bent inflating bag is arranged on the upper surface of the upper part of the membrane, the opening end of the bent inflating bag faces to the water collecting bag, the water collecting bag is propped open through a shaping strip, and the bent inflating bag is connected with an inflating and deflating device through an inflating pipe.
Further, the water collecting bag is funnel-shaped.
Further, the lower end of the water collecting bag is provided with a flow guide channel communicated to the inside of the water collecting bag.
Further, the blind end of the bent air inflation bag extends to the inside of the water collecting bag.
Further, the bent inflatable bag is U-shaped or C-shaped.
Further, the inflation and deflation device is an inflatable rubber ball which is pinched by hands.
The utility model has the beneficial effects.
The bent inflatable bag can effectively prevent the waste flushing fluid from flowing outwards or seeping outwards, protects the sterility of an operation area, can lead the waste water to be drained into the water collecting channel, and has simple structure and easy popularization.

Detailed Description
With reference to the accompanying drawings, the embodiment provides a water-retaining membrane for a spinal endoscopic surgery, which comprises a membrane 1, wherein the membrane 1 with different sizes can be individually selected according to the size of a surgical area. The double-faced adhesive tape 2 is arranged on the lower surface of the upper part of the skin membrane 1, so that the utility model can be pasted around the operation incision.
The lower part of involucra 1 sets up bag 3 that catchments, and bag 3 that catchments is the infundibulate, and bag 3 that catchments struts through moulding strip 9, and bag 3 that catchments is used for keeping off the flush fluid of collection. The lower extreme of water collection bag 3 is provided with the water conservancy diversion passageway 7 that communicates to the inside water collection bag 3, conveniently discharges the inside abandonment flush fluid water conservancy diversion of water collection bag 3 to the outside.
The upper surface of the upper part of the involucra 1 is provided with a bent inflatable bag 4, the bent inflatable bag 4 is U-shaped or C-shaped, the open end of the bent inflatable bag 4 faces the water collecting bag 3, and the blind end 8 of the bent inflatable bag 4 extends into the water collecting bag 3 to prevent flushing liquid from overflowing everywhere.
The bent inflatable bag 4 is connected with an inflation and deflation device 6 through an inflation tube 5, the inflation and deflation device 6 can be an inflatable rubber ball which can be pinched by hand, and the bent inflatable bag 4 can be inflated and deflated through the inflation and deflation device 6. The curved air bag 4 after the inflation and the bulging can shield the waste flushing fluid generated in the operation, prevent the outflow or the exosmosis, and drain the flushing fluid into the water collecting bag 3 and discharge the flushing fluid into a sewage cylinder placed below the water collecting bag 3 through the flow guide channel 7. After use, the air in the bent air-filled bag 4 is discharged through the air charging and discharging device 6, and the utility model is folded and collected.
